Types of Addiction Treatment Available in Jamestown
Detoxification Programs
Detoxification, or detox, is often the first step in addiction treatment. It involves medically supervised withdrawal to safely clear the body of addictive substances. Detox in Jamestown is supported by specialized centers that provide 24/7 monitoring, minimizing withdrawal risks and discomfort.
Inpatient Rehabilitation
Inpatient rehab offers intensive, residential care where patients stay at the facility. This setting provides structured therapy, medical support, and peer community, creating an environment conducive to recovery from severe addiction cases.
Outpatient Programs
For individuals with milder addiction or those transitioning from inpatient care, outpatient programs offer flexibility. Patients attend scheduled therapy sessions while continuing to live at home and manage daily responsibilities.
Counseling and Therapy
Behavioral therapies are central to addiction treatment in Jamestown. Common approaches include c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), motivational interviewing, and group counseling, all designed to address the psychological aspects of addiction and teach coping skills.
Support Services and Aftercare in Jamestown
Peer Support Groups
Groups such as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A) provide ongoing support for people in recovery. These community-driven meetings help individuals stay accountable and connected after formal treatment ends.
Sober Living Homes
For many, transitioning from inpatient rehab directly back to regular life can be challenging. Sober living environments in Jamestown offer a substance-free residence with peer support to reinforce sobriety goals.
Family Support and Education
Effective addiction recovery often involves family members. Jamestown treatment providers offer family therapy and educational sessions to improve communication and strengthen the support network surrounding the patient.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1. How long does addiction treatment typically last?
Treatment duration varies depending on individual needs, the substance involved, and treatment type. Detox may last a few days, inpatient rehab usually runs from 30 to 90 days, and outpatient programs can extend for several months.
Q2. Are addiction treatment services in Jamestown covered by insurance?
Many centers accept insurance plans, including Medicaid and Medicare. It’s essential to verify coverage with your provider and the treatment facility before beginning care.
Q3. Can I continue working or going to school while in treatment?
Outpatient programs are designed to accommodate work and school schedules, allowing patients to maintain daily responsibilities while receiving care.
Q4. What if I relapse after treatment?
Relapse is a common part of recovery. It should be viewed as an opportunity to reassess and strengthen the treatment plan. Many centers offer additional support and relapse prevention strategies.
Q5. Are family members involved in treatment?
Yes, many programs encourage family participation to foster a supportive environment and improve long-term success.
